[QUOTE="Marc Hugo, post: 1168705, member: 15915"] Hi Gerd, it might be tricky getting fresh cassettes in SA, but they are available overseas. Hitachi-Maxell still make the Maxell UR and excellent results are possible with those. Despite the various high prices to be seen on FleaBay and Yahoo Japan, there are deals to be had. You can literally buy freshly made cassettes from National Audio Company in the USA, Missouri if I recall correctly. They have their own brand, so to speak. Quality is excellent. Prices might sound forbidding on occasion on US or German eBay, when one compares the "numbers" from memory with what we paid in 1985, but in adjusted dollars, euros and Rands it's often not to bad.
